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
  • 2 cloves minced garlic
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es (to taste)
  • Salt and pepper

Instructions

  1. In a medium bowl, whisk together honey, olive oil, red wine vinegar, garlic, oregano, red pepper flakes, salt, and pepper.
  2. Marinate the chicken in the mixture for at least 30 minutes (up to 4 hours).
  3.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Place marinated chicken in a baking dish.
  4. Mix crumbled feta with a drizzle of olive oil, salt, and pepper; top each chicken breast with this mixture.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C) and the feta is golden.
  6. Let rest for 5 minutes before serving with fresh herbs.
